Roof rake boards are installed in different widths based on the surface being covered.
Also is there a simple way to create a beveled column along the z axis from top to bottom.
One by 2 inch rake boards often cover the exposed top edge of the siding when there also is an eave overhang on the gable end.

The rake of a roof is the outer edge that runs from the eave to the ridge or peak of the roof.
It is typically perpendicular to the eave.
